Description
An organization representing art therapists in the state of Illinois.
Member benefits
Access to professionals in the field within the state of Illinois
Discounts on the conference and two workshops
Two free workshops per year
Opportunities to present professionally
Exhibition opportunities
Networking
Free annual luncheon
Quarterly newsletter (two paper and two e-newsletters)
Mission / Aims
The Illinois Art Therapy Association (IATA) is an organization of professionals dedicated to the belief that the creative process involved in the making of art is healing and life enhancing. It's mission is to service its members and the general public by endorsing standards of professional competence and promoting knowledge in the field of art therapy.
